Microwave Radiometry at Frequencies From 500 to 1400 MHz: An Emerging Technology for Earth Observations
Microwave radiometry has provided valuable spaceborne observations of Earth's geophysical properties for decades. The recent SMOS, Aquarius, and SMAP satellites have demonstrated the value of measurements at 1400 MHz for observing surface soil moisture, sea surface salinity, sea ice thickness...
